Our Daily Bread is an Athens soup kitchen founded and housed at Oconee Street Methodist Church and supported by over 20 churches and organizations in the Athens Area.
Volunteers from St. James are committed to provide lunch for Athens' hungry on the second Friday of each month, serving 100 or more.

St. James Contributes $3,000 to the Renovation of the Our Daily Bread Kitchen
Last year, members of St James fasted and prayed for the ministry at Our Daily Bread. Many contributed the money they would have spent on lunch toward a much needed renovation of the Our Daily Bread kitchen. We collected money over two Sundays from the day of fasting, ultimately sending in approximately $3000 for the renovation.
